Page 154: ...achine Setting Up Fax Features Setting Up Contacts and Contact Groups Sending Faxes Receiving Faxes Viewing a Fax on the LCD Screen Checking Fax Status Connecting a Telephone or Answering Machine You must connect your product to a telephone wall jack to send or receive faxes If you want to use the same telephone line to receive calls you can connect a telephone or answering machine to your product...

Page 155: ...Note If you have a DSL or ISDN connection you must connect the appropriate DSL filter or ISDN terminal adapter or router to the wall jack to be able to use the line for faxing or voice calls using your product Contact your DSL or ISDN provider for the necessary equipment DSL connection 155 ...

Page 295: ...ion setting to retain a high image quality Increase the resolution by the same amount you increased the image size For example if the resolution is 300 dpi dots per inch and you will double the image size later change the resolution setting to 600 dpi Note Higher resolution settings result in larger file sizes which take longer to process and print Consider the limitations of your computer system ...

Page 301: ...ated topics Selecting Epson Scan Settings Scanned Image Colors Do Not Match Original Colors Printed colors can never exactly match the colors on your computer monitor because printers and monitors use different color systems monitors use RGB red green and blue and printers typically use CMYK cyan magenta yellow and black Check the color matching and color management capabilities of your computer d...
